Brigham City man arrested after disconnecting gas lines, threatening to blow up home with girlfriend inside

Jeremy Ruben Perea, a 44-year-old man from Brigham City, has been arrested on one charge of aggravated assault (third-degree felony). He allegedly threatened to blow up their home with his girlfriend inside, causing police to evacuate nearby homes. The pair live in separate units in the same residence. Police responded to the scene and found that Perea had been tampering with gas lines and had turned on the electric stove. He is currently on probation for a previous incident of domestic violence.
